To turn off the "Service Now" light on a VW Jetta, follow these steps:
- Turn the ignition on: Make sure the ignition is on, but do not start the engine.
- Press and hold the trip reset button ("0.0"): This button is typically located on the right side of the instrument cluster.
- Release and press the clock adjustment button ("M"): After releasing the trip reset button, quickly press the button labeled "M" or the clock adjustment button on the left side of the instrument panel.
- Turn the ignition off and back on: Once you've completed the steps above, turn the ignition off. Then, turn it back on to verify if the "Service Now" light has been reset.
This method should reset the service indicator light on most VW Jetta models. If the light persists, you may need to consult the vehicle’s owner's manual for more detailed instructions specific to your model year.
